Date a Live - Season 2

Season 2
Episodes

Daily Life
Shido and the Spirits are back, but Tohka`s powers are unstable as she and Origami continue to compete for Shido`s attention.

Hurricane Children
Shido`s class goes on a trip to DEM-affiliated Arubi Island, where he and Tohka get separated from the class and encounter twin Spirits.

Two Requests
The tables are turned as Kaguya and Yuzuru try to make Shido fall in love with them.

Manifestation
In the air, the Fraxinus is under attack while Kotori is away, and Shido and Tohka are being attacked on the ground while Kaguya and Yuzuru fight their last duel.

Diva
Shido meets Miku Izayoi, an idol also known as the Spirit, Diva, while getting ready for the joint cultural festival with other schools in Tengu City.

Girls' Music
The Tenou Festival begins, and Shido has to cross-dress to participate in the activities as Shiori to satisfy Miku.

Gabriel
When the results of the first day of the Tenou Festival are announced, Miku decides she doesn`t want to play by the rules anymore.

The Promise to Keep
With Kurumi`s help, Shido tries to convince Miku to join him in rescuing Tohka, and Miku has second thoughts about her stance on Shido.

The Truth About Miku
Shido learns more about Miku`s past, and they go to rescue Tohka together as Mana, Origami, and the others fight the Wizards.

Inversion
Shido has to find a way to deal Tohka`s inverted form as the battle outside continues. Will he be able to restore order to the city?
